For high-volume production runs of facility plastic components, injection moulding preponderates. This well-known method entails infusing molten plastic under high pressure right into an exactly designed mold and mildew tooth cavity. As soon as cooled and solidified, the plastic takes the form of the mold, producing consistent, resilient components suitable for whatever from toys and electronics rooms to automotive elements and clinical devices. While shot moulding excels in automation, 3D printing solutions in Melbourne offer a game-changer for low-volume, intricate prototypes. This revolutionary technology allows designers and engineers to bring their visions to life with incredible detail and flexibility. 3D printers work by building three-dimensional objects layer by layer, utilizing an electronic model as a blueprint. The materials used in 3D printing are substantial, varying from common plastics like ABS and PLA to innovative alternatives like nylon, steel, and also biocompatible products for clinical applications. The rapid turn-around times used by 3D printing services make them optimal for quick prototyping iterations, permitting developers to check and fine-tune their ideas prior to committing to pricey manufacturing runs.

For tasks requiring unrivaled precision and control, CNC machining solutions in Melbourne provide the utmost service. CNC (Computer Numerical Control) machining makes use of computer-aided layout (CAD) software application to control computerized machine devices. This permits extremely exact cutting, drilling, and shaping of a large range of products. From delicate components for electronics to high-strength parts for the auto sector, CNC machining can take care of also one of the most requiring projects. The capability to work with numerous products like aluminum, steel, timber, and also plastics makes CNC machining a flexible choice for suppliers in Melbourne.

Enhancing this change towards lasting power are solar inverters, which play an essential function in solar power systems. Solar inverters transform the direct current (DC) created by solar panels right into alternating existing (A/C), which is used by a lot of household home appliances and fed right into the electrical grid. The performance and dependability of solar inverters are important for the efficiency of solar energy systems, making them a key component in the fostering of renewable energy.
